Key Responsibilities:

Independently develops and/or supervises the creation of engineering products that meet customer quality requirements. This includes defining the problem, establishing the work scope, preparing the budget and schedule, planning the work, providing technical direction, and reporting the work status. Typical products may include detailed calculations, drawings, procurement documents, design and installation packages, proposal evaluations, technical reports, and detailed analyses. Develop detailed requisitions for equipment and materials. May supervise one or more subordinates and provide input regarding performance. Provides input and technical guidance to CAD Designer/Drafters, Designers, and lower level Engineers working on the same project. Perform additional responsibilities as required by the position.

Qualifications:

Bachelor's degree in Engineering or a related field. Minimum of 5 years of relevant work experience with highway geometric design background. Engineer in Training (EIT) Certificate may be required, and candidate should be on the PE track. Proficiency in CAD (Microstation and InRoads/OpenRoads) and other PC software packages commonly used in engineering. Experience with NYSDOT highway design projects preferred.
